OverviewNCBI Gene
This gene encodes a protein which contains a zinc finger-like PHD (plant homeodomain) finger, distinct from other classes of zinc finger motifs, and a hydrophobic and highly conserved domain. The PHD finger shows the typical Cys4-His-Cys3 arrangement. PHD finger genes are thought to belong to a diverse group of transcriptional regulators possibly affecting eukaryotic gene expression by influencing chromatin structure. Seroatlas reads PHF2 as an antibody target. Whether an autoantibody or antibody against PHF2 could matter depends on whether native PHF2 is physically reachable, whether the body needs it intact, and whether it acts in a disease-relevant tissue.
PHF2 is annotated as predominantly intracellular. Intracellular proteins are common autoantibody markers, becoming visible to the immune system after cell injury or altered processing, but are usually markers of disease rather than direct drivers.
